UP Board Class 12 Chemistry 2026 Set 347 EC Exam Pattern and Marking Scheme

Set 347 EC is a bilingual (Hindi and English) paper split into five sections that move from 1-mark MCQs up to 5-mark long answers, so you clear the objective block first and then budget time for the descriptive part.

  • Total questions: 26 questions across Sections A to E
  • Total marks: 70 (theory); duration 3 hours 15 minutes including 15 minutes reading time
  • Section A: Question 1 (a to f) is 6 MCQs of 1 mark each
  • Sections B and C: short-answer questions of 2 marks each
  • Section D: a mix of 3-mark and 4-mark questions, including a case-based scheme
  • Section E: long-answer Questions 6 to 9 of 5 marks each, with an internal OR choice

High-Weightage Chapters in UP Board Class 12 Chemistry 2026 to Focus On First

Marks in this paper cluster around a handful of units, so revising these first gives the fastest return. In Set 347 EC the physical and organic units carried most of the 5-mark load.

  • Electrochemistry: the single heaviest unit at roughly 9 marks, with a Nernst equation or conductance numerical almost every year
  • Aldehydes, Ketones and Carboxylic Acids: about 11% of the theory paper, tested through named reactions and conversions
  • Coordination Compounds: reliable source of a 4-mark case-based question on IUPAC naming and crystal field theory
  • Chemical Kinetics: a 3-mark rate-law or half-life numerical from Section D
  • d- and f-Block Elements: short-answer questions on lanthanoid contraction and oxidation states
  • Haloalkanes, Amines and Biomolecules: the printed organic reaction schemes and conversion chains sit here
